In a new step towards the future of urban transportation, Dubai’s Roads and Transport Authority (RTA) has signed an agreement with The Boring Company, owned by entrepreneur Elon Musk, to develop the “Dubai Loop” project—an underground high-speed transport system set to revolutionize mobility within the emirate. Partnership Announcement at the World Governments Summit

The announcement of this ambitious project was made on Thursday, on the sidelines of the World Governments Summit in Dubai, where Musk revealed details of the project in a video call with Omar Sultan Al Olama, Minister of State for Artificial Intelligence, Digital Economy, and Remote Work Applications.

Musk explained the concept of the project, saying:

“It will enable people to travel within Dubai as if they were moving through a wormhole, reducing long distances and traffic congestion.”

Project Details and Technical Specifications

The “Dubai Loop” project aims to establish a 17-kilometer underground transport system featuring 11 stations, utilizing self-driving electric vehicles capable of transporting over 20,000 passengers per hour, with the potential to increase this capacity to more than 100,000 passengers in the future. This system features direct travel technology with no intermediate stops, meaning each vehicle will transport passengers straight to their final destination without stopping at other stations. This will significantly reduce travel time within Dubai. The vehicles are expected to travel at speeds of up to 160 kilometers per hour, allowing for seamless travel between key areas of the emirate in just a few minutes.

Resemblance to the “Vegas Loop” Project in the U.S.

“Dubai Loop” is an extension of the “Vegas Loop” project developed by The Boring Company in Las Vegas, USA, which became operational in 2021. Both projects rely on tunnel systems designed to reduce traffic congestion, providing a fast and sustainable transport alternative powered by electricity instead of fossil fuels. Project Goals and Impact on Dubai Residents

The project aims to enhance the quality of life in Dubai by offering a fast, safe, and sustainable transportation method to ease congestion and reduce environmental pollution. Commenting on the project’s significance, Omar Sultan Al Olama stated:

“The project will cover Dubai’s most densely populated areas, allowing people to move from point to point seamlessly. We hope to change people’s lives with this advanced system.”

Advantages of Tunnels Over Aerial Transport

During his discussion at the summit, Musk highlighted why tunnel-based transport is a more efficient alternative to aerial transportation, such as planes and flying cars. He pointed out several key advantages of tunnels, including:

  • Safety: Protected from extreme weather conditions.
  • Noise Reduction: Unlike airplanes and helicopters.

When Will the Project Begin?

As of now, no official timeline has been set for the commencement of excavation or the actual operation of the “Dubai Loop” project. However, the initial agreement between Dubai and The Boring Company marks a crucial first step toward achieving this groundbreaking technological milestone.
